25 / 104 page ![]() Finite state machine in the LIS2DUXS12 LIS2DUXS12 accelerometer data can be used as input of up to 8 programs in the embedded finite state machine (FSM); also the embedded temperature or analog hub (AH) / Qvar sensor data can be processed in FSM logic (Figure 11. State machine in the LIS2DUXS12). All 8 finite state machines are independent: each one has its dedicated memory area and it is independently executed. An interrupt is generated when the end state is reached or when some specific command is performed. Figure 11. State machine in the LIS2DUXS12 FSM x SIGNAL CONDITIONING X = 1..8 Acc [LSB] Temp/AH/Qvar [LSB] LIS2DUXS12 FSM output 5.7 Machine learning core The LIS2DUXS12 embeds a dedicated core for machine learning processing that provides system flexibility, allowing some algorithms run in the application processor to be moved to the MEMS sensor with the advantage of consistent reduction in power consumption. Machine learning core logic allows identifying if a data pattern matches a user-defined set of classes. Typical examples of applications could be activity detection like running, walking, driving, and so on. The LIS2DUXS12 machine learning core works on data patterns coming from the accelerometer sensor, but it is also possible to process the embedded temperature sensor data or the analog hub (AH) / Qvar data. The input data can be filtered using a dedicated configurable computation block containing filters and features computed in a fixed time window defined by the user. Computed feature values and filtered data values can also be read through the FIFO buffer. Machine learning processing is based on logical processing composed of a series of configurable nodes characterized by "if-then-else" conditions where the "feature" values are evaluated against defined thresholds. Figure 12. Machine learning core in the LIS2DUXS12 Machine learning core logical processing Sensor data Computation block Decision tree Accelerometer Results Temperature/AH/Qvar Features Filters Meta-classifier The LIS2DUXS12 can be configured to run up to 4 decision trees simultaneously and independently and every decision tree can generate up to 16 results. The total number of nodes can be up to 128. The results of the machine learning processing are available in dedicated output registers readable from the application processor at any time. The LIS2DUXS12 machine learning core can be configured to generate an interrupt when a change in the result occurs. LIS2DUXS12 Machine learning core DS14035 - Rev 2 page 25/104 |
